Fundamentally, a hurricane a storm that produces winds at or above 100 miles/hour. It's caused by an atmospheric circulation that is closed at low levels and is identified by a high-pressure center and an intricate arrangement of thunderstorms. It also brings massive rain and squalls.
Eyewall replacement cycleIn the event of a tropical storm that is intense, there will be a new wall that replaces the previous. The replacement eye can be much bigger and stronger than the previous eye. It's typically seen in major hurricanes. Also known as the concentric eyewall cycle.
In the middle in the process of replacing the eyewall in the course of eyewall replacement, the intensity of the hurricane usually decreases. This process can last at least two days. The eyeball of a hurricane may grow by five to fifteen miles in size. This could be a devastation storm. But accurate hurricane forecasts will help protect people affected by the hurricane.
It is common for hurricanes to undergo a series of eyewall replacement cycles. The largest eyewalls are typically visible in a top-of-the-line category four hurricane. If you are in the West Pacific, double eyewall designs are typical.
Saffir-Simpson scaleUtilizing the Saffir-Simpson hurricane scale using the scale of Saffir-Simpson, hurricanes are classified into five categories based on wind speed. Storms that have sustained winds between 74-95 miles per hour can be classified into Category One, however, those that have sustained winds over 120 miles per hour are classified as Category 5.
The Saffir-Simpson hurricane scale is utilized mostly throughout North America. It's used in assessing the strength of tropical cyclones in both the Atlantic as well as North Pacific oceans. The scale is utilized for assessing hurricane strength and their potential damages to properties.
The hurricane intensity scale was a United Nations project that was changed in the late 1970s through Robert Simpson, a meteorologist. This scale is employed to forecast hurricanes within the United States and was also used to provide public warnings about the potential effects of hurricanes.
Eyewall size and formThe ability to understand an eye's size and form of a hurricane could help weather forecasters make better predictions. Hurricanes with small eyes are not usually very strong. A larger eye could increase the size of the storm and push water inland in the way of surges.
A hurricane's eyes can be circular, oval or even oval. The shape of the eyes is normally dependent on the speed of the wind and direction. In general, wind gusts in an eyewall tend to be the most powerful and intense. The strongest winds in the eyewall are found near 500 m elevation.
The eye of a storm is usually clear of clouds. In weaker cyclones clouds can block their eyes. cyclone. The stadium effect is the appearance like an open dome in the air.
Preparing for a hurricanePreparing for a hurricane is one of the best ways to protect you and your belongings. In the beginning, you need to pay attention to the forecast for weather. Then you should develop your own hurricane preparedness checklist, as well as prepare a Hurricane supply kit.
If you experience a hurricane, it is recommended that you need to remain indoors and stay avoid windows. It may also be necessary to evacuate. But, you should check for official updates about the hurricane before you go. This gives you time to prepare.
If you're in a zone that is affected by hurricanes, then you should begin to familiarize yourself with areas of shelter. It is also important to stock your refrigerator and freezer with water. Also, make plans for meeting with your family members in the event that there is a need to evacuate.
The storm season starts June 1 through November 30. The weather can be unpredictable and forecasts may change quickly. Check your home insurance to ensure that you have enough coverage.
